Masoneilan SVi1000 Digital Valve Positioner

Masoneilan SVi1000

 

Certifications:

  • ATEX, FM, IEC, and CSA approvals. Intrinsically safe and non-incendive (energy limited)

Communication Platform:

  • HART revision 5 or revision 7 (field selectable)

Signal – Supply:

  • 4-20 mA control signal. No external power required. Supply pressure: 20 – 100 psi (1.4 – 7 bar)

The Masoneilan SVi1000, is an intuitive 4-20 mA digital valve positioner equipped with HART™ Protocol, designed specifically for single-acting pneumatic control valves utilizing established magnetic position measurement technology. 

 

Masoneilan SVi1000 Advantages

    • Simplified and expedited commissioning and startup processes for control valves 
    • Consistent and precise valve positioning 
    • Compliance with HART 5 or 7 for both local and remote configuration and commissioning 
    • Compatibility with a wide range of control systems, handheld devices, and asset management software 
    • Reduced component count due to integrated valve position feedback and limit switches 

     

    Characteristics 

      • User-friendly local interface featuring a “One-button-one-function” design 
      • Durable, non-contact, shielded magnetic travel sensor 
      • Sturdy metal housing suitable for industrial environments 
      • Versatile design applicable to both linear and rotary valve operations 
      • Intrinsically safe design 
      • Built-in diagnostics including cycle counts, step tests, ramp tests, and system health indicators 
      • Full integration with all major DCSs, supporting DD, eDDL, or DTM 
      • Universal labeling with approvals from FM, FMc, ATEX, IEC, and CE 
      • Advanced DTM offering an intuitive interface for commissioning, calibration, tuning, diagnostics, and maintenance.
